Take advantage of our pathways to Deakin
You might need to spend some time improving your academic scores or English before you start your Deakin course. You can do this at Deakin College or the Deakin University English Language Institute (DUELI) – they're both on campus in Australia, which means you can get to know your campus, fellow students and Deakin staff before you start your degree.
Spend some time studying at Deakin
Complete part of your undergraduate, postgraduate or research degree with Deakin's study abroad program and you'll earn credit points towards your degree back home. Choose to study one to two trimesters or complete a full academic year as an exchange student.

Study in Australia
Apply for your student visa online
As a student from Nepal, you may be eligible to study and live in Australia on a student visa. Once your student visa has been issued, it will be valid for your whole course of study (as long as you meet all your visa conditions). You can apply for your student visa online or with the help of one of our representatives in your country.
You can work part time while you study
You'll be able to work up to 40 hours a fortnight while you're studying in Australia on a student visa. If you're not studying during trimester 3 (our non-compulsory trimester) you can work unlimited hours.
